 [Image]  We updated the Javascript Tracker You can now accurately track page view durations, scroll depth and more.  [Woopra URL Variables] Hi {NAME},  We’re excited to release a new version of our website Javascript Tracking code. Woopra will now track your page views duration more accurately. We will also be tracking the scroll depth percentage for every page view.  But wait, there's more to it. Developers now have the ability to update a page view action after it has been tracked. This will create a lot of opportunities to track the user experience at a deeper level, enriching any action with data that was difficult to achieve in the previous version.  To learn more about what's new, [check out this blog post]( that summarizes the changes.  Note: The Javascript Snippet has not changed. You don't need to make any updates to your tracking code. Do you want to learn more? [Learn more]( Woopra has been named a Fall 2021 Leader by G2!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
